1978. PAL, Pratapaditya. THE IDEAL IMAGE: THE GUPTA SCULPTURAL TRADITION AND ITS INFLUENCE. Washington, DC: The Asia Society in association with John Weatherhill, Inc., 1978. 144 pp. Oblong 4to., beige cloth with gilt spine and cover lettering. Near fine, ink ownership to front flyleaf, gently bumped corners. Dust jacket in good condition with one 3 inch closed tear to front panel, a few nicks to edges and sunning to spine. B/w and color photographs.
